How Our Storm Surge Damage Cleanup Process Works
Tackling storm surge damage requires a systematic approach. Simply drying out surfaces isn’t enough; you need a process that addresses every affected material and potential hazard. When water invades your home, it brings debris, contaminants, and can weaken structural components. Cutting corners here can lead to persistent mold problems and long-term structural instability. Our methodical cleanup ensures all moisture is removed and materials are properly treated. We follow industry best practices to restore your home safely.
Initial Assessment and Safety Check
The first thing we do is assess the full extent of the damage and ensure the property is safe to enter. This involves checking for electrical hazards and structural integrity. We’ll walk you through our findings, explaining exactly what needs to be done. This initial inspection is critical for planning the next steps.
Water Extraction
Using powerful pumps and specialized vacuums, we remove standing water from your home as quickly as possible. The faster we extract the water, the less damage occurs to your belongings and structure. Rapid water removal is key to preventing further issues.
Drying and Dehumidification
Once the bulk of the water is gone, we set up industrial-grade drying equipment, including air movers and dehumidifiers. These machines work continuously to lower humidity levels and dry out affected materials like drywall, wood, and carpets. Consistent drying prevents mold and warping.
Cleaning and Sanitization
Storm surge water can carry contaminants. We thoroughly clean and sanitize all affected surfaces, including walls, floors, and any salvageable personal items. This step is vital for your family’s health and safety. Proper sanitization eliminates harmful bacteria and odors.
Structural Drying and Material Removal
Sometimes, materials like soaked drywall, insulation, or flooring can’t be salvaged. We’ll carefully remove these items to allow for proper drying of the underlying structure. Our goal is to salvage what we can while ensuring a healthy environment. We meticulously dry the structure to prevent long-term problems.

Warning Signs You Need Storm Surge Damage Cleanup
Ignoring early signs of storm surge damage can lead to more significant and expensive problems down the line. Catching these issues early means a faster, more effective cleanup. Addressing damage promptly saves you time and money. Your property’s health depends on quick action.
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away
A persistent musty smell, especially in lower levels or after a storm, is a strong indicator of hidden moisture and potential mold growth. These odors signal underlying issues that need professional attention.
Visible Water Stains or Discoloration
Water marks on walls, ceilings, or floors are obvious signs of water intrusion. These aren’t just aesthetic problems; they mean the materials are saturated and potentially compromised. Stains indicate water damage that requires thorough drying.
Peeling or Bubbling Paint and Wallpaper
As moisture gets behind paint or wallpaper, it can cause them to peel, bubble, or blister. This is a clear sign that water is present and affecting the integrity of your finishes. Bubbling paint suggests moisture behind the surface.
Soft or Warped Flooring
If your hardwood floors feel soft, look warped, or your carpet feels spongy underfoot after a surge, the subfloor and flooring materials are likely saturated. This can lead to rot and structural weakness. Warped floors need immediate attention to prevent further damage.
Mold or Mildew Growth
Any visible signs of mold or mildew, often appearing as black, green, or white fuzzy patches, indicate a moisture problem that needs immediate remediation. Mold growth is a health hazard and requires professional removal.
Doors and Windows That Stick or Won’t Close Properly
Water saturation can cause wood frames and structures to swell, making doors and windows difficult to open or close. This warping is a sign that the surrounding materials are holding excess moisture. Sticking frames signal moisture impact.
Storm Surge Damage Cleanup vs. DIY: When To Call a Professional
| Situation | DIY? | Call a Pro? | Why |
|---|---|---|---|
| Standing water less than an inch deep in a small, isolated area. | Yes, with proper safety precautions. | Maybe. | If you have the right safety gear and ventilation, you might be able to manage it. |
| Water has seeped into walls or under flooring. | No. | Yes. | Hidden moisture is hard to find and dry completely, leading to mold. |
| Any signs of mold or mildew growth. | No. | Yes. | Mold can be a serious health risk and requires specialized containment and removal. |
| Damage affecting electrical outlets or wiring. | Absolutely not. | Yes. | Electrical hazards are extremely dangerous and require certified professionals. |
| Saturated structural materials like beams or load-bearing walls. | No. | Yes. | Structural integrity is paramount; professionals can assess and repair hidden damage. |
| You need to file an insurance claim for the damage. | No. | Yes. | Professionals provide the detailed documentation insurance companies require. |
For storm surge damage, especially when water levels are significant or have affected structural components, calling a professional is almost always the best course of action. DIY efforts often fall short of completely drying and sanitizing. Professional intervention ensures safety and long-term protection.
Storm Surge Damage Cleanup Cost In Redan, GA
The cost of storm surge damage cleanup in Redan, GA, can vary widely depending on the extent of the flooding, the size of your property, and the types of materials affected. These figures are general estimates. Accurate pricing requires an on-site assessment. We work to provide fair estimates for your situation.
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Water Extraction | $500 – $3,000 | Volume of water, size of affected area, accessibility. |
| Structural Drying (Air Movers & Dehumidifiers) | $750 – $4,000 | Number of units needed, duration of drying time, size of space. |
| Mold Remediation (if necessary) | $1,000 – $10,000+ | Severity of mold growth, area affected, containment needs. |
| Sanitization and Deodorization | $300 – $1,500 | Area treated, type of sanitizing agents used, odor intensity. |
| Material Removal (Drywall, Flooring, etc.) | $500 – $5,000+ | Amount of material removed, type of materials, disposal fees. |
| Insurance Claim Assistance & Documentation | Often included in overall service cost or a small separate fee. | Complexity of the claim, level of detail required. |
These ranges are for illustrative purposes. We offer free, detailed estimates after a thorough inspection of your property. Understanding your costs upfront is important to us.

Common Questions About Storm Surge Damage Cleanup
How quickly do I need to call for storm surge damage cleanup?
You should call for storm surge damage cleanup as soon as it’s safe to do so, ideally within 24-48 hours. Rapid response is critical to prevent secondary damage like mold growth and structural weakening. Our team is available to respond quickly to your needs.
Will my insurance cover storm surge damage cleanup in Redan, GA?
Coverage varies greatly depending on your specific insurance policy. Standard homeowners insurance often doesn’t cover flood damage, but flood insurance might. We help document the damage thoroughly to support your claim. Navigating insurance can be complex, and we aim to simplify it for you.
What are the health risks associated with storm surge water?
Storm surge water is often contaminated with sewage, chemicals, and bacteria, posing significant health risks. Direct contact can lead to infections and skin irritations. Proper cleanup and sanitization are essential to protect your health. Our certified technicians handle these hazardous materials safely.
How long does the storm surge damage cleanup process usually take?
The timeline depends heavily on the severity of the damage, the size of your home, and the extent of drying required. A simple extraction and drying might take a few days, while extensive damage requiring material removal could take weeks. We provide realistic timelines after our initial assessment. Our goal is efficient restoration without sacrificing quality.
Can I prevent storm surge damage from happening again?
While you can’t prevent storms, you can take steps to mitigate potential damage. This includes maintaining your property’s drainage systems, ensuring sump pumps are working, and considering flood barriers if you’re in a high-risk area. Proper maintenance reduces risk.
